Job Description

Join Nexus Quantum Labs at the forefront of computational revolution. We're pioneering quantum algorithms that will redefine industries by 2026. As a Quantum Computing Research Scientist, you'll develop breakthrough protocols in error correction and quantum machine learning, collaborating with Nobel laureates and industry disruptors. Our state-of-the-art facility in San Francisco offers unparalleled resources and a culture where your ideas become reality.

Responsibilities

  • Design and implement quantum algorithms for optimization and cryptography problems
  • Lead cross-functional teams in developing fault-tolerant quantum computing architectures
  • Publish peer-reviewed research in top-tier journals and present at international conferences
  • Collaborate with hardware teams to translate theoretical models into practical applications
  • Secure research grants and partnerships with leading academic institutions
  • Mentor junior researchers and drive innovation in quantum machine learning

Qualifications

  • PhD in Physics, Computer Science, or related field with quantum computing focus
  • 3+ years of hands-on experience with quantum programming languages (Q#, Qiskit)
  • Proven track record of published quantum algorithm research
  • Expertise in quantum error correction and decoherence mitigation
  • Strong background in linear algebra, probability theory, and computational complexity
  • Experience with superconducting or ion-trap quantum systems
